Cyprus is resisting pressure from the European Commission (EC) and International Monetary Fund (IMF) to sell its gold reserves to finance its “bailout”.
Yesterday the Cypriot Finance Minister said that a sale of its gold reserves was not the only option under consideration to pay down its debt and that other alternatives were being considered.
Cyprus has 13.9 tonnes (c. 447,000 troy ounces) of gold reserves which are worth some 436 million euros at today’s market prices.
The international bailout imposed on Cyprus involved 10 billion euro ($13 billion) and therefore the Cypriot gold reserves are worth a mere 4.36% of the bailout.
"The possibility of selling gold is known, but only as an option," Finance Minister Harris Georgiades told reporters. He did not elaborate on what the alternatives were according to Reuters.
The government in Cyprus may realize that in the event of Cyprus leaving the euro and returning to the Cypriot pound, their gold reserves could provide support to the fragile newly launched national currency.

http://www.erstegroup.com/en/Downloads/ ... 10f734.pdfIn many countries, interest rates are near their lowest levels since records began. In July 2012, 10-year yields in the US thus reached with 1.39% the lowest level since the beginning of records in the year 1790. In the Netherlands – which provide the longest available time series for bond prices – interest rates fell to a 496 year low. In the UK, 'base rates' are currently at the lowest level since the founding of the Bank of England in 1694. In numerous countries (Germany, Switzerland), short term interest rates even fell into negative territory. Never before has there been such a low interest rate environment on a global basis.

Old topic. The chart of GDXJ got me to thinking.John wrote:Dear Higgie,
The hypothesis is that Bass, Paulson and Burry were simply lucky.
There were thousands of people trying to make money in the real estate
market, and some of them were bound to do well just as a matter of
luck, and those three were the lucky ones. Once they lucked out, then
they made up some facts to explain their success besides luck. That's
the hypothesis.
Does anyone have any evidence that this hypothesis is wrong?
John
All 3 of these guys have been bullish on gold for a couple years if memory serves correctly and I do not think they were in from low levels nor did they sell. I vaguely remember reading this week that Paulson's gold fund has lost 65%.
John, this seems to be further evidence that your hypothesis is right. If any one of these 3 guys really could predict markets with the accuracy that they predicted the real estate market, they would not have been caught. If they ride it out, they may well be lucky one more time.
